Volleyball Rebounds with 3-0 Win Over Smith
Wenham, Mass. - The Framingham State University volleyball team was back in action this morning at the Gordon College Invitational and defeated the Smith College Pioneers 3-0 in non-conference action at the Bennett Center.
THE BASICS:
- Score: The Rams defeated the Pioneers 25-23, 26-24, and 25-13.
- Records: Framingham State (1-1), Smith (0-2)
- Location: Wenham, Mass. – Bennett Athletic Center
INSIDE THE NUMBERS:
- Sophomore Brandey Rodriguez (Lawrence, Mass.) paced the Rams with eight kills on 14 attempts with just one error for a .500 hitting percentage. Rodriguez also added six service aces and five defensive digs.
- Sophomore Grace Caughey (Mendon, Mass.) followed with seven kills and a team-best 16 digs.
- Senior Mackenzie Whalen (Norton, Mass.) collected 23 set assists, three aces and 14 digs, while junior Deirdre Fay (Cornwall, NY) chipped in with 16 digs and four kills.
- Freshman Alyssa Cafarelli (Peoria, AZ) recorded a career-high 12 digs in the match.
- Smith was led by nine kills from Caleigh Johnson and a match-high 30 digs from Anna Lynch.
